Instead of hitting all animals at once, thought I'd put this on the Stonebrunt page. The Tigers, Tigresses, Granitbacks (Elder and Highland) have dropped numerous Runes for me.
Most have been labelled as dropping the Rune of Karana. Although I've got a couple of these, I've also got Runes of: Concussion, Rallos Zek, Arrest, Fulguration, Helix, Dismemberment, Regeneration, Al'Kabor, and Xegony. The rune drops are kind of sporadic, but they fall a reasonable amount of time.
I've also had various words drop from these mobs. Forgot, I also actually got one Eye of Serilis to drop. According to Alla it is used for a Magician research spell.

If you care, most of the names of the mobs are written in Khowar, which is a language mostly spoken in Chitral, which is found in the far North Eastern part of Pakistan:
Ademzada = aristrocrat Awrat = woman Ghazi = veteran holy warrior Ispusar = sister Mamluk = servant Mujahed = holy warrior Pasdar = he/she, who awaits Khonza = Queen Amir/a = prince,ruler/princess Shazda = prince Puzhal = name of a city Tseq = child
